The second Clydeside leader featured in this panel is Jimmy Maxton. He can be seen in the foreground.

Maxton, a member of the "Independent Labour Party", was elected as an MP in 1922. He was one of ten MPs known as the "Clydesiders".

He was also one of the leaders of the "40 Hour Strike". In the painting he is shown encouraging protestors during that strike. The red flag - Clyde Workers - links the 1915-1916 and 1918 movements.
